INSTALLATION

Introduction.

___________ _
This chapter explains how to configure and install the PC
AD1200 board into a PC compatible computer. Detailed
instructions are given how to set the i/o address select DIP
switches as well as how to set the IRQ, DMA jumper blocks. In
addition, the jumpers configuring the Analogue to Digital input
and the two Digital to Analogue outputs are explained.
Finally details of how to connect up the AD1200 to the users
own system are given.
If the PC AD1200 is to be installed in another make of PC
then it may be necessary to consult the instructions included in
that PC's documentation.
The two third size PC AD1200 board will fit into both
long or a short slots, it can be placed in standard 8 bit PC slots
or in the longer 16 bit AT slots.
If you have a Micro Channel Architecture computer such
as the IBM PS/2 Models 50-90 then you require our PS AD1200
card instead.
